Career Resource Center (CRC)
The CRC is available to students Monday through Thursday from 8:00am to 6:00pm and from 8:00am to 5:00pm on Fridays. Resources include:

  • Major Binders — Contain a one page fact sheet for every major which describes job opportunities and the skills required.
  • Career Books — Publications about different career fields, grouped in the CRC by major area of study.
  • Job Search Resources — Books, guides, and directories to help students prepare for the job search process.
  • Company Literature — Employer profiles, directories, annual reports, and videotapes assist students in conducting company research.
  • Computer Lab with Internet Access — Available for students to look for jobs on-line, create résumés, research employers, and more.
  • Résumé Samples — Provide an example of what a résumé can contain. There are samples for most all majors at Georgia Southern.
